1st Bn, Berkshire Regiment - A sepia photograph of the officers of the Battalion who rode with the Calpe Hunt in Gibraltar in 1883 showing, from left to right,Lieutenant C. Turner, Lieutenant G.S. Swinton, Lieutenant W.K. McClintock, Lieutenant C. Evans-Gordon, Colonel A.G. Huyshe, Lieutenant F.B.R. Hemphill, Lieutenant A.J.W. Dowell, Major C.B. Bogue, Captain H.W. Holden. [Lieutenant Swinton later took part in the Battle of Tofrek in which he was the only officer from the Regiment to lose his life.]

1st Bn, Royal Berkshire Regiment - A black and white photograph of the Battalion Tug-of-war team in Ireland, believed to have been in 1910. This team were the winners of the Bronze medal, tournament, Irish Command ands second in the Naval and Military Tournament at Olympia, London. It shows in the rear row from left to right L/Corporal Kimber, L/Corporal Sawyer, Colour Sergeant Vesey, Sergeant Fullbrook (Coach), Colour Sergeant Brooks, Sergeant Justice and Sergeant Smith and, siitting from left to right, are Drummer Thompsett, Private Gardiner, Lieutenant Colonel A.J.W. Dowell, Captain B.G. Bromhead, Private Priceand L/Corporal Wilkins.
